I'm a little confused about something. I won't be able to take Orgo until my junior year. I'm going to need about three or four months to study after that for the MCAT. So I'll end up taking the MCAT in either late July or Early August. When does the application cycle start and would taking the MCAT in the late summer put me at a disadvantage?

You can search for other threads regarding late AMCAS applications; this topic has been extensively discussed.

In short, taking the MCAT in late July or early August would put you at a great disadvantage unless you’re are otherwise an extraordinary applicant. AMCAS opens for data entry in early May and is open for submission on June 1. A late July exam means your results won’t be available until late August, which is a late time to have your primary application complete. Most applicants will have their interviews already scheduled when you are submitting your secondary applications.

I would be better off waiting another year and applying in 2014, instead of 2013?

No one here should really be telling you what to do. All I will say is that an AMCAS that is complete in late August / early September is late. This can hurt you in a system that for the most part operates on a first-come-first-serve basis. The vast majority of all applicants will be complete long before you are.
